Title: Is It Illegal to Destruct Railway Communication Cables?

Destructing railway communication cables is a serious offense that can cause significant harm to the transportation system. Railway communication cables are vital components of the railway infrastructure, responsible for maintaining communication between trains and the central control system. These cables carry important information such as train locations, speed, and direction, which are crucial for ensuring the safe and efficient operation of the railway network. ,Destroying these cables can lead to severe disruptions in train communication, causing trains to collide or run off track. This can result in catastrophic consequences, including loss of life and property damage. Therefore, it is illegal to deliberately damage or destroy railway communication cables under any circumstances. Those who violate this law can face severe penalties, including fines and imprisonment. It is essential for all individuals to understand the importance of preserving and protecting the railway infrastructure to ensure the safety and reliability of the transportation system. By working together, we can help maintain a safe and efficient railway network for everyone to use.

In today's modern and interconnected world, the importance of efficient communication systems cannot be overstated. These systems have revolutionized the way we travel, work, and conduct business. Among these systems, railway communication cables play a pivotal role in ensuring smooth and uninterrupted train operations. However, with their crucial function comes a significant responsibility to protect these vital infrastructures. This article explores the legality of destroying railway communication cables and the potential consequences of doing so.

At its core, the question of whether it is illegal to destroy railway communication cables revolves around two main aspects: the lawfulness of the action and its potential impact on society.

Firstly, let us examine the legality of destroying railway communication cables. Most countries have specific laws governing the protection of critical infrastructure, including railway communication cables. These laws often outline penalties for individuals or organizations found guilty of damaging such infrastructure. In some cases, breaking or destroying communication cable facilities can result in hefty fines and even imprisonment. Additionally, these laws often carry stricter punishments for those who intentionally cause harm or damage to critical infrastructure with malicious intent. Therefore, from a legal standpoint, destroying railway communication cables is generally considered an offense under these laws.

However, beyond mere legal compliance, there are also broader social and societal implications that must be considered. Railway communication cables are not only essential for train operations but also contribute significantly to society's welfare. The disruption caused by damaged or destroyed communication cables can lead to delays, safety hazards, and financial loss for both passengers and businesses. Moreover, the consequences of such actions can have a ripple effect on other sectors like transportation, manufacturing, and logistics. Thus, from a societal perspective, the destruction of railway communication cables can have far-reaching negative impacts.

Now that we have examined the legality and societal implications of destroying railway communication cables, let us discuss how individuals can protect this vital infrastructure. One crucial step is education and awareness. By understanding the importance of railway communication cables and their role in society, individuals can develop a sense of responsibility towards their protection. Furthermore, individuals can report any suspicious activities or damages to relevant authorities promptly. This proactive approach can help prevent potential incidents before they occur.

Another effective strategy is the use of advanced technology to monitor and maintain communication cable facilities. Modern tools like sensors and remote monitoring systems can detect anomalies and provide real-time information about cable conditions. This allows for timely interventions to prevent or mitigate damages before they occur. Additionally, regular maintenance checks and repairs can help identify and address potential issues before they escalate into more significant problems.

In conclusion, destroying railway communication cables is generally illegal, as it violates laws governing the protection of critical infrastructure and can have far-reaching negative impacts on society. As individuals and members of society, we have a collective responsibility to protect this vital infrastructure through education, awareness, proactive reporting, and the use of advanced technology. Ultimately, our collective efforts can ensure the safe and efficient operation of railway communication systems, contributing to our society's overall well-being.
